Starting Up a New Business, a Soft Skill Class with Lanny Anggawati

  • News Release
  • 21 March 2016, 09.01
  • Oleh: english-sv
  • 0

English Study Program class of 2015 who joined the Soft Skill class attended a workshop with the theme STARTING UP A NEW BUSINESS which was held on Saturday, March 12, 2016 with the speaker, Mrs. Lanny Anggawati.

The training aims to build and motivate students in dealing with all problems for students both in activities inside of lectures or outside of lectures. Ms. Lanny also conveyed that it is important to prepare themselves starting from college in the face of increasingly heavy globalization competition. In addition, to about sixty-five students who were present also attended the Head of English Study Program, Dr. Endang Soelistiyowati, M.Pd., along with Ms. Agnes Siwi, M.Pd, a lecturer in English Study Program, looked enthusiastic listening to the discussion of the material presented very neatly and enthusiastically.
